
Easy Chicken and Dumplings in the Crockpot

Recipe at a Glance
Prep Time: 20 minutes
Cook Time: 6 hours
Total Time: 6 hours 20 minutes
Servings: 6
Ingredients
- 1.5 lbs bo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 4 cups chicken broth
- 1 cup carrots, diced
- 1 cup celery, diced
- 1 medium onion, ch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tsp dried thyme
- 1 tsp dried parsley
- 1/2 tsp black pepper
- 1 can (10.5 oz) cream of chicken soup
- 1 can (16 oz) refrigerated biscuit dough
- Salt to taste
Instructions
- Place the chicken breasts in the bottom of the crockpot. Add the chicken broth, carrots, celery, onion, garlic, thyme, parsley, black pepper, and cream of chicken soup. Stir to combine, ensuring the chicken is submerged.
- Cover and cook on low for 6 hours or on high for 3 hours, until the chicken is fully cooked and tender.
- Once cooked, remove the chicken breasts and shred them with two forks. Return the shredded chicken to the crockpot.
- Open the can of biscuit dough and cut each biscuit into quarters. Drop the biscuit pieces on top of the chicken mixture in the crockpot. Do not stir; just let them sit on top.
- Cover and cook for an additional 30 minutes on high, or until the biscuits are puffed and cooked through.
- Once the dumplings are ready, stir gently to combine before serving. Taste and adjust seasoning with salt, if needed.
- Serve hot and enjoy this comforting crockpot chicken and dumplings!
Tips for the Perfect Chicken and Dumplings
To enhance the flavor of your chicken and dumplings, you may consider adding other vegetables such as peas or corn. Additionally, fresh herbs can elevate the taste even further. If you prefer a creamier texture, adding a splash of heavy cream or milk towards the end of cooking can be delightful. Remember, the key to flavorful dumplings is not to overcook them!

Serving Suggestions
This chicken and dumplings dish is hearty enough to be a meal on its own, but it pairs wonderfully with a simple side salad or steamed vegetables for a more balanced dinner. Serve with some crusty bread to soak up the delicious broth.
Storing and Reheating
If you have leftovers, store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. To reheat, simply place in a pot over medium heat, stirring occasionally until warmed through. You may need to add a splash of chicken broth to loosen the mixture.
